+/**
+ * addClass adds a class to the given element
+ * animate calls the underlying library's animate functionality
+ * appendElement appends a child element to a parent element.
+ * bind binds some event to an element
+ * dragEvents a dictionary of event names
+ * extend extend some js object with another. probably not overly necessary; jsPlumb could just do this internally.
+ * getDragObject gets the object that is being dragged, by extracting it from the arguments passed to a drag callback
+ * getDragScope gets the drag scope for a given element.
+ * getElementObject turns an id or dom element into an element object of the underlying library's type.
+ * getOffset gets an element's offset
+ * getOriginalEvent gets the original browser event from some wrapper event.
+ * getScrollLeft gets an element's scroll left. TODO: is this actually used? will it be?
+ * getScrollTop gets an element's scroll top. TODO: is this actually used? will it be?
+ * getSize gets an element's size.
+ * getUIPosition gets the position of some element that is currently being dragged, by extracting it from the arguments passed to a drag callback.
+ * initDraggable initializes an element to be draggable
+ * initDroppable initializes an element to be droppable
+ * isDragSupported returns whether or not drag is supported for some element.
+ * isDropSupported returns whether or not drop is supported for some element.
+ * removeClass removes a class from a given element.
+ * removeElement removes some element completely from the DOM.
+ * setDraggable sets whether or not some element should be draggable.
+ * setDragScope sets the drag scope for a given element.
+ * setOffset sets the offset of some element.
+ */
